Johnson Controls, Inc. Federal Spending Profile

Johnson Controls, Inc. is a smaller federal recipient, with $53.0M in total federal obligations across 25 awards in the USAspending.gov record. That places Johnson Controls, Inc. #1430 among federal contractors ranked by total obligations.

Every one of Johnson Controls, Inc.'s 25 federal awards is a procurement contract rather than a grant — the company sells goods or services to the government rather than receiving grant funding.

Johnson Controls, Inc.'s largest federal customer is Department of Defense, at about 70% of its top-agency obligations, followed by Department of Health and Human Services. The company holds award relationships with 6 agencies in total, but its revenue leans toward that lead customer.

What the federal government buys from Johnson Controls, Inc. is led by Other Services ($221.4M), followed by Construction ($12.0M); together these categories describe the goods and services the company is paid to deliver.

Its largest single recent award is a $26.4M contract from the Department of Defense, described in the federal record as "Espc D.O. #2 Ft. Eustis:."
